Biography

Ellen Pogemiller is a Democratic member of the Oklahoma House of Representatives, representing District 88 . Born in Texas and hailing from Paris, Texas, she assumed office on November 20, 2024, with her current term ending November 18, 2026. Pogemiller has dedicated her career to public service and advocacy, winning her seat in the 2024 elections by defeating opponents in both the Democratic primary and general election. Notable priorities include increasing school funding to the regional average, raising teacher pay, recruiting top educators, expanding access to reproductive healthcare, rolling back strict abortion laws, and improving voting access through mail-in ballots, same-day registration, online registration, and extended early voting. She recently conducted an Interim Study on causes and solutions to chronic absenteeism in schools before the Common Education Committee.

Education and Political Experience

  • Education: Earned a bachelor’s degree from the University of Missouri.
  • Professional Background: Worked as an advocate addressing constituent issues before entering politics, building skills in social justice, economic development, and community well-being.
